301. Deputy Éamon Ó Cuív asked the Minister for Further and Higher Education, Research, Innovation and Science the arrangements that have been made to ensure that students from Northern Ireland will continue to be treated as previously in Irish universities post Brexit as far as fees and so on are concerned;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[36064/20]
